Chris Posted January 16, 2007 Report Share Posted January 16, 2007 I had that same problem a long time ago with some 8's i bought off a guy. thats one of the many issues with cheap speakers. in the rush to mass produce, the thing is 1 or both the metal plates that the magnet is in between isnt on straight or cut wrong causing the coil to rub ever so much. (nothing you can really do) since the baskets are usually stamped instead of bolted to the motor structure.
